Laurel Munson Boyer’s family moved to the Raymond area in 1890. She is the 5th generation to live and work in these foothills and eventually in Yosemite, where her great grandfather brought in the first phone lines and provided lodging for early park visitors. Her grandparents staffed the fire lookout on Deadwood in their young marriage, and Laurel’s parents worked many years in Yosemite before moving to Oakhurst. Laurel was born in Yosemite Valley and has lived inside the park for almost 60 years, culminating in a wonderful career as the park’s first female wilderness manager.Laurel will be sharing stories of her life, including how and why our most precious wild public lands are protected.
